A heavy, rounded sans with compact proportions and softly blunted terminals. Curves are broad and smooth, with generous counters that stay open even at this weight. Many joins and diagonals read as slightly squared-off, giving forms a sturdy, blocky rhythm while keeping an overall round silhouette. The lowercase is simple and sturdy, with single-storey shapes where expected and short, thick strokes that maintain consistent density across the set.

Best suited for headlines, short statements, and display typography where maximum impact and quick recognition are needed. It works well for branding, packaging, labels, and signage, especially in playful or retro-leaning contexts. In longer text blocks, it is most effective at larger sizes where the generous counters can breathe.

The overall tone is friendly and upbeat, with a toy-like boldness that feels welcoming rather than aggressive. Its chunky geometry and rounded detailing evoke a retro, pop-forward attitude suited to attention-grabbing messages and casual branding.

The design appears intended to deliver a bold, approachable display voice by combining rounded geometry with sturdy, compact construction. It prioritizes high visual presence and clarity at large sizes, aiming for a friendly, pop-centric feel rather than a neutral text tone.

The uppercase has strong, compact shapes that hold together well in all-caps settings, while the numerals are similarly bold and legible with clear interior shapes. The heavy weight creates a dark color on the page, so spacing and line breaks become part of the aesthetic in longer passages.
